With Russia being the world’s largest country in terms of land size, one may think that they’d have access to all the cars imaginable. Furthermore, with Russia slowly growing in wealth, expensive cars are now becoming all too common and both the Bentley EXP 9 F and Lamborghini SUV’s are being created with Russia in mind. However, there has long been a gaping hole in Russia’s artillery and that was easy access to a Lamborghini dealership.

This initially surprised us greatly, and will no doubt surprise you also, that a country this large with such an incredible love for high performance cars isn’t home to a dealership from one of the world’s most renowned supercar manufacturers. As a result, all Lamborghini’s currently purchased in Russia are either second-hand or imported thousands of miles in from surrounding countries.

However, that’s all about to change as Automobili Lamborghini recently teamed up with the Burevestnik Group to officially begin development and production of a new dealership in Moscow, the country’s capital.

The construction of this new dealership will allow all Russian citizens to have a taste of Lamborghini and how they operate, with merchandise and other accessories also set to be sold at the dealership. While the new place is being constructed, a temporary showroom and sales office has been set up in the Crocus City Mall.

Additionally, the dealership will also provide all current Lamborghini owners residing in Russia and all prospecting buyers the ability to have their cars serviced in their home country, by specialists rather than just any odd mechanic around the corner. As a result, sales in Russia are likely to increase exponentially, and before long, Lamborghini should be turning a profit after repaying off all the construction costs.
